Essential Considerations for River Rafting Clothing

Selecting appropriate garments for river rafting is crucial for safety and comfort. This section outlines vital considerations to ensure a positive experience on the water.

Tip 1: Prioritize Quick-Drying Fabrics: Opt for synthetic materials such as polyester or nylon, which wick away moisture efficiently. Avoid cotton, as it retains water and can lead to hypothermia in cooler conditions. For example, a quick-drying long-sleeved shirt provides sun protection and temperature regulation.

Tip 2: Layer Strategically: Utilize multiple thin layers to adjust to changing weather conditions. A base layer of moisture-wicking fabric, an insulating mid-layer like fleece, and a waterproof outer layer provide versatility. Adding or removing layers as needed maintains a comfortable body temperature.

Tip 3: Choose Appropriate Footwear: Wear closed-toe shoes that provide secure footing and protection. Sandals or flip-flops are not recommended due to the risk of injury and loss. Neoprene booties or water shoes with sturdy soles are excellent options.

Tip 4: Protect Against Sun Exposure: Even on cloudy days, the sun’s rays can be intense on the water. Wear a wide-brimmed hat, sunglasses with UV protection, and apply sunscreen liberally to exposed skin. Reapply sunscreen throughout the day.

Tip 5: Consider Water Temperature: In colder water, neoprene wetsuits or drysuits are essential to prevent hypothermia. The water temperature directly influences the level of insulation required. Check water temperatures prior to rafting and choose appropriate thermal protection.

Tip 6: Secure Loose Items: Ensure all personal belongings, such as sunglasses and hats, are securely attached to prevent loss. Use straps or lanyards to keep items close. Lost items pose a safety hazard and inconvenience.

Tip 7: Select Bright Colors: Choosing brightly colored outerwear can increase visibility in the event of an emergency. High visibility can aid rescue efforts. Avoid drab or dark clothing that can blend into the surrounding environment.

2. Layering Essential

2. Layering Essential, River

Layering is a fundamental principle in selecting appropriate attire for river rafting, dictated by the dynamic environmental conditions encountered on the water. Effective layering provides adaptability and protection against a spectrum of variables, from intense sun exposure to sudden temperature drops and unexpected immersion.

  • Base Layer Functionality

    The base layer, worn closest to the skin, serves to manage moisture. Materials such as merino wool or synthetic fabrics are preferred for their wicking properties. A base layer efficiently draws sweat away from the body, preventing the sensation of dampness and reducing the risk of evaporative cooling. For instance, during a warm day with intermittent splashes, a moisture-wicking base layer maintains comfort, whereas a cotton alternative would retain moisture, leading to discomfort and potential chilling as the day progresses.

  • Insulating Mid-Layer Options

    The mid-layer provides thermal insulation. Fleece, down, or synthetic fill jackets are commonly employed. The primary purpose is to trap warm air and maintain core body temperature. The choice of mid-layer depends on the ambient temperature and anticipated water conditions. On a cooler day or when rafting in cold water, a thicker fleece or a lightweight down jacket provides necessary warmth. In contrast, during warmer conditions, a lighter fleece or even foregoing the mid-layer may be appropriate.

  • Protective Outer Layer Requirements

    The outer layer is designed to shield against wind and water. A waterproof and windproof jacket and pants are crucial components. This layer prevents rain and wind from penetrating the inner layers, maintaining dryness and warmth. For example, a rafter caught in an unexpected downpour without a waterproof outer layer would quickly become soaked and chilled, significantly increasing the risk of hypothermia. A durable, waterproof outer layer mitigates this risk, providing a critical barrier against the elements.

  • Adjustability and Adaptability

    The ability to adjust the layers is a key benefit of this approach. By adding or removing layers, individuals can fine-tune their clothing to match changing conditions. During periods of intense activity, layers can be removed to prevent overheating. Conversely, when conditions cool or during periods of inactivity, additional layers can be added to maintain warmth. This adaptability is essential for maintaining comfort and safety throughout a river rafting excursion.

4. Sun Protection

4. Sun Protection, River

Effective sun protection is an indispensable component of appropriate river rafting attire. Prolonged exposure to ultraviolet (UV) radiation, exacerbated by reflection off the water’s surface, poses significant risks to participants. Incorporating sun protection measures into river rafting clothing mitigates these risks and enhances overall safety and comfort.

  • Protective Fabric Selection

    The choice of fabric plays a critical role in sun protection. Tightly woven fabrics with a high Ultraviolet Protection Factor (UPF) rating offer enhanced shielding from UV rays. Examples include long-sleeved shirts and pants made from UPF-rated materials, which block a significant percentage of harmful radiation. This proactive measure reduces the risk of sunburn and long-term skin damage. A typical scenario involves a rafter wearing a UPF 50 shirt, effectively minimizing UV exposure compared to wearing a standard cotton shirt.

  • Headwear and Neck Coverage

    Wide-brimmed hats are essential for shielding the face, ears, and neck from direct sunlight. These areas are particularly vulnerable to sunburn. Additionally, neck gaiters or bandanas can provide supplemental coverage, protecting the back of the neck and lower face. An example is a rafter wearing a wide-brimmed hat and neck gaiter, significantly reducing the risk of sunburn on exposed areas compared to a bareheaded individual.

  • Sunglasses and Eye Protection

    Sunglasses with UV protection are vital for safeguarding the eyes from harmful radiation. Prolonged exposure to UV rays can lead to cataracts and other eye damage. Polarized lenses further enhance visual clarity by reducing glare from the water’s surface. Consider a rafter wearing polarized sunglasses, experiencing improved visibility and reduced eye strain compared to someone without proper eye protection.

  • Sunscreen Application

    While clothing provides a physical barrier, sunscreen is necessary for exposed skin. Broad-spectrum sunscreen with a high Sun Protection Factor (SPF) should be applied liberally and reapplied frequently, particularly after water exposure. Areas such as the hands, face, and ears require diligent attention. For instance, a rafter applying SPF 50 sunscreen every two hours on exposed skin minimizes the risk of sunburn and associated skin damage.

The integration of these sun protection elements into river rafting attire constitutes a comprehensive strategy for mitigating the risks associated with UV radiation. By combining protective clothing, headwear, eyewear, and sunscreen, rafters can significantly reduce the potential for sunburn, eye damage, and long-term skin complications, ensuring a safer and more enjoyable experience on the water.

5. Water Temperature

5. Water Temperature, River

Water temperature exerts a decisive influence on the selection of appropriate clothing for river rafting, directly impacting thermal regulation and overall safety. Understanding the interplay between water temperature and its effect on the human body is paramount for ensuring a comfortable and secure rafting experience.

  • Hypothermia Risk Mitigation

    Cold water, defined as temperatures below 70F (21C), poses a significant hypothermia risk. Prolonged exposure to such temperatures leads to rapid heat loss, potentially resulting in life-threatening conditions. River rafting attire designed for cold water conditions incorporates insulating materials like neoprene or drysuits, which minimize heat loss and maintain core body temperature. A real-world example is a rafter inadvertently submerged in a river with a water temperature of 55F (13C) without adequate thermal protection; that individual would experience rapid hypothermia onset, necessitating immediate rescue and rewarming procedures. Therefore, appropriate attire acts as a crucial barrier against the debilitating effects of cold water.

  • Neoprene Wetsuit Functionality

    Neoprene wetsuits are a common solution for rafting in cool to moderately cold water. These suits trap a thin layer of water between the neoprene and the skin, which is then warmed by body heat, providing insulation. The thickness of the neoprene varies depending on the water temperature, with thicker suits offering greater thermal protection. For example, a 3mm wetsuit may suffice for water temperatures between 65-75F (18-24C), while a 5mm or thicker suit may be necessary for colder conditions. The use of a wetsuit effectively reduces heat loss and extends the duration rafters can safely spend in the water.

  • Drysuit Application

    Drysuits offer superior protection in extremely cold water environments. These suits are waterproof and feature seals at the neck, wrists, and ankles, preventing water from entering and maintaining a layer of dry air inside. Drysuits are often paired with insulating layers underneath to provide additional warmth. An instance where a drysuit is essential is rafting in glacial-fed rivers with water temperatures near freezing. Without a drysuit, rafters face an immediate and severe hypothermia risk. The integrity of the seals and the quality of the insulating layers are vital to the drysuits effectiveness.

  • Warm Water Considerations

    While hypothermia is a primary concern in cold water, warm water conditions above 75F (24C) present different challenges. In such environments, the focus shifts towards sun protection and maintaining comfort. Lightweight, quick-drying fabrics, such as those with UPF ratings, are essential to prevent sunburn and overheating. Breathable clothing allows for efficient sweat evaporation, reducing the risk of heatstroke. An example is a rafter in a tropical climate opting for a lightweight, long-sleeved UPF shirt to shield against intense sun exposure, while still maintaining breathability and comfort. Therefore, attire selection in warm water prioritizes protection against solar radiation and heat exhaustion.

6. Securing items

6. Securing Items, River

The practice of securing items is intrinsically linked to river rafting apparel, representing a critical safety measure. This aspect transcends mere convenience, directly influencing the well-being and operational effectiveness of participants. Unsecured items present a hazard, potentially leading to loss, damage, or even contributing to dangerous situations within the river environment.

  • Retention Systems Integration

    River rafting attire frequently incorporates integrated retention systems designed to secure personal belongings. These systems may include zippered pockets, clip-in points, or adjustable straps. The purpose is to keep essential items, such as knives, whistles, or communication devices, readily accessible and prevent their inadvertent loss during rapid maneuvers or unexpected submersion. An example is a rafting jacket featuring multiple zippered pockets and D-rings for attaching essential gear. This integration allows for quick access while minimizing the risk of equipment becoming detached and lost in the water.

  • Eyewear and Headwear Security

    Sunglasses and hats are crucial for protection against sun exposure, but they can easily be dislodged during rafting activities. River rafting attire often includes features that enhance the security of these items, such as sunglass retainers (straps that attach to the temples of sunglasses) and hat clips (which secure a hat to clothing). These simple additions significantly reduce the likelihood of losing eyewear or headwear in the event of turbulence or sudden movements. Without these safeguards, essential sun protection can quickly be lost, compromising the rafter’s comfort and safety.

  • Personal Flotation Device (PFD) Attachment Points

    The personal flotation device, while not strictly clothing, functions as an integral part of river rafting attire. PFDs are equipped with attachment points designed to secure items necessary for safety and rescue, such as knives, rescue strobes, or signaling devices. These attachment points ensure that essential safety equipment remains readily accessible in emergency situations. For instance, a PFD with a knife attached in a designated sheath allows a rafter to quickly cut free from entangled ropes. Securing such items to the PFD ensures their availability during critical moments.

  • Waterproof Pouches and Containers

    To protect sensitive items such as electronic devices, medications, or identification, waterproof pouches and containers are often incorporated into river rafting attire or carried as accessories. These pouches ensure that essential items remain dry and functional, even after prolonged exposure to water. Examples include waterproof phone cases with lanyards that can be attached to a PFD or clothing. The use of such pouches is essential for maintaining the functionality of communication devices and protecting vital personal effects from water damage.
